190 Social Media Mayhem
It is time to take control of our social media habits. Today I talk about social media mayhem, a hot topic that so many beauty pros are trying to navigate right now. In this episode, I share a personal story about negative emotions that social media can trigger and how to replace them with things that bring you joy. I also share an easier way to incorporate social media into your business growth strategy and explain the five social media elements to no longer tolerate. Finally, I explain how to enroll in my upcoming free training where I share my social media management system.
Listen in to learn Lori’s “no-longers,” how much time to spend on social media daily, and tips for creating genuine connections with your followers.

About the Author
A finalist for American Spa Magazine’s 2017 Women in Wellness Mentor of the Year, Lori Crete is a highly sought after industry expert and licensed celebrity esthetician. Owner of Southern California’s Spa 10, she is also the founder of The Beauty Biz Club™, a success-based society dedicated to helping beauty practitioners around the world fill their schedule, increase profits and break through to the 6-figure mark.
